Output 59fe313d8bfa1bb817d2907758afeae0289ace768bf28fb5221829233828f052:3

value
2289022
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2ea13bf217d5a1d8c289a1b9520b4c8f4f177120 OP_EQUAL
address
35waA7ZgqeTj2XJgPaa41hGtEsCkuTQahX
transaction
59fe313d8bfa1bb817d2907758afeae0289ace768bf28fb5221829233828f052
spent
true